    However I have recently been getting sore mouth and tongue and throat that comes and goes on a daily basis and i have asked the Dr and they just dismissed it but is this a likely side effect of the drug as i cant find a conclusive link.
    This is possibly glossodynia, aka oral dysaesthesia, commonly called burning-mouth syndrome which is a potential side-effect of many antidepressants and other psychiatric medication. Not all perceive it as a burning sensation, but more as generalised soreness. Alpha-lipoic acid and/or magnesium supplements may help.

    Ill source some Magnesium, is there a particular type that is better for absorption etc ?
    Avoid magnesium hydroxide, oxide and sulphate as they have low bio availability. Magnesium citrate is probably the most popular, but it can act as a laxative in some as may the carbonite form. Most of the others are okay. Magnesium glycinate supposedly is the most bio available and to be least likely to induce diarrhoea, but I understand it can be more expensive. Whether it is worth the extra I can't say. Fwiw, I take magnesium for muscle cramps and am currently on magnesium taurate because it was on special at the time of purchase. It seems to work well enough.

    Don't go overboard on dosing as too much can cause imbalances with other minerals, especially calcium. Around 300mg elemental magnesium daily should be okay long term, but check with your GP the next time you see him/her. Note: supplements should state two doses, the quantity of the magnesium type and also how much elemental magnesium this is equivalent to. The two doses are sometimes printed on different areas of the label, presumably to confuse and confound us mere mortals for marketing purposes.
